<trademark>Kubuntu</trademark> comes with the <application>Dragon Player</application> video player installed by default. It is a simple and light-weight video player that can play almost any video file, provided the necessary codecs are installed. For video editing, the preferred choice is <application>Kino</application>&mdash; a non-linear video editor. <application>Kino</application> is not installed by default in <trademark>Kubuntu</trademark>, but can be easily installed from the <trademark>Kubuntu</trademark> Software Center: (<application>Muon</application>), which can be started by choosing <menuchoice><guimenu>K menu</guimenu><guisubmenu>Computer</guisubmenu><guimenuitem>Muon Software Center</guimenuitem></menuchoice>.
